HSMP ( Tier 1 ) FAQ
Reading time: 2 - 4 minutes
General
=======
- What will be visa status for wife/husband whose main applicant has HSMP ( Tier 1 ) visa ?
In HSMP ( Tier 1 ) visa scheme all dependants gets the same visa ,so they will be also be allowed to work legally fulltime for any employer.
Previous Earning
================
- For calculating previous earning , one should count CTC ( Cost to Company ) or net take home salary ?
Its CTC.it includes bonus or any income which is reflected in your payslip.
- How many months earning one need to show to become eligible for Tier 1 visa ?
Earnings must be made up of 12 consecutive months and must fall within the 15 months before your application.
You can claim points for a 12-month period outside of the 15-month period only in very limited circumstances. These are if you have been away from the workplace for a time during the last 12 months because of:
* full-time study; or
* a period of maternity or adoption-related absence.
You do not have to be in continuous employment during the 12-month period being assessed, so:
* you can claim for a period of earnings less than 12 months; and
* earnings do not have to be from a single employer and can be from full-time, part-time, temporary or short-term work.
If you claim for a period that is more than the 12 months, UK Home office will assess the most recent period of 12 months for which you have sent evidence.
Maintainence Fund
=================
- What is maintenance fund requirement for HSMP ( Tier 1 ) Visa ?
To qualify for Tier 1 (General) of the Points Based System you must be able to demonstrate that you have funds to support yourself and any dependants. For the main applicant this is £2,800 with a further £1,600 needed for each dependant accompanying you or planning to join you within 12 months of your arrival in the UK.A These amounts must be held in your personal bank account for a minimum period of 3 months for which you must show bank statements/other evidence immediately preceding and dated no more than 7 days prior to the date you submit your application. The balance should not fall below the required minimum at any time during the 3 month period.
- Can i withdraw the fund once visa has been issued ?
Yes.You can.
- Does UK BA consider the FD ( Fixed Deposit ) for Maintenence fund ?
Fixed Deposite are valid for Maintenance fund as long as they can be liquidated when required.
Joint Account will be fine for maintainence fund or not ?
cash savings in a joint account that have been in your joint account for at least three months before your application is valid.
- International Account is valid for Maintenance Fund or not ?
cash savings in a account overseas (They convert the amount to pounds sterling using the rate which appears on the OANDA website, and the date on your bank statement), that have been in your account for at least three months before your application is valid.

I wanted to enquire about definition of maintenance fund for Tier 1 General Category (Entry Level).
I have a Joint Fixed Deposit of 2 Laces with my elder brother (real brother), he is primary account holder and I am secondary account holder, will this kind of Fixed Deposit work fulfilling maintenance fund requirement.
I have read this instruction in UK VFS site http://www.ukvisas.gov.uk/en/howtoapply/infs/inf21pbsgeneralmigrant
“Documentary evidence for Maintenance (Funds)
Evidence must be in the form of cash funds. Other accounts or financial instruments such as shares, bonds, pension funds, etc., regardless of notice period are not acceptable. If you wish to rely on a joint account as evidence of available funds, you must be named on the account along with one or more other named individual.”
But I am not sure about the exact definition of maintenance funds in this case.
